**We are looking for a Claims Advisor** **to join our team in our Montreal office**

As a Claims Advisor, you will be responsible for processing clients’ claims by reviewing relevant policies, investigating losses, conducting coverage analysis, and reporting losses to the insurer. You will also be responsible for liaising between the client and the insurer to guarantee maximum satisfaction and maintain good relationships with both parties.

**Your day as a Claims Advisor**
- Review relevant policies upon notification of a new claim and report loss to the insurer.
- Confirm coverages included in the insurance policy.
- Review claims’ documentation.
- Estimate damages and losses suffered to settle the claim and appoint vendors as necessary.
- Conduct claims and coverage analysis and recommend solutions to coverage issues.
- Negotiate payments and reimbursements with the insurers on the client’s behalf.
- Update the client on the status of the claim as needed.
- Enter and maintain current and accurate information in the appropriate electronic file system.
- Maintain current and accurate files and documentation for each claim
- Build and maintain excellent relationships with adjusters, insurers, and suppliers.
- Prepare and update loss bordereaux.
- Conduct monthly meetings with clients to provide updates on active claims.
- Comply with corporate policies and procedures.

**Who we are**

Founded in 1987 by Barry F. Lorenzetti, BFL CANADA is one of the largest employee-owned and operated Risk Management, Insurance Brokerage, and Employee Benefits consulting services firms in North America. The firm has a team of over 1,300 professionals located in 26 offices across the country. Our employees have free rein to demonstrate their creativity, leadership, and entrepreneurial skills since we believe in each one of them. BFL CANADA is a founding Partner of Lockton Global LLP, a partnership of independent insurance brokers who provide Risk Management, Insurance, and Benefits Consulting services in over 140 countries around the world.
